Farm Assistant (Part-time)

Windrush Farm is a leading therapeutic riding center based in North Andover, MA. Located on 38 acres of attractive fields and woodlands, the rural property is surrounded by conservation land.  This position aids in the successful operation of this non-profit organization that is focused on improving the lives of clients with disabilities.

The overarching responsibility is to help the Farm Manager provide a first-class environment for our therapy horses. Only healthy, happy horses can perform well in the programs

This position is for 20 hours a week, Monday through Friday and pays $20 per hour.  The schedule is flexible though morning hours are preferred.  Candidates must have their own transportation.

Responsibilties

Duties include mowing pastures and lawns, adverse weather preparation, snow removal, fixing fences, operating and maintaining machinery and tools.   

Qualifications

Previous farming/landscaping experience required, as well as the ability to lift up to 50 lbs. and work outdoors in all weather conditions.
